> I have several projects that include bash-completions, and am trying
> to get a new one through package review. The reviewer has raised a
> question about whether the package should own:
>
> %dir %{_datadir}/bash-completion/completions
>
> My existing projects have basically cargo-culted the bash-completion
> packaging, so I thought I would see if there are official guidelines,
> but I'm not finding anything. Do we have guidelines?

I've filed:
https://src.fedoraproject.org/rpms/bash-completion/pull-request/4
to create a bash-completion-filesystem package to own the directories.
Could we move /etc/bash_completion.d/ from filesystem to
bash-completion-filesystem then and make it a core installed package?
